Abstract

The chemical formulation of the title compound was established as trans-[PtCl{P(C2H5)3(CO)}BF4 by single-crystal X-ray analysis, in contrast to the five-coordinate tetra-fluoro-ethyl-ene complex that had been anti-cipated. The compound had been prepared by reaction of trans-PtHCl(P(C2H5)3)2 with C2F4 in the absence of air, and the presence of the carbonyl group was not suspected. The square-planar cations and BF4 - anions are linked by C-H⋯F and C-H⋯O inter-actions into thick wavy (010) sheets. The present crystal-structure refinement is based on the original intensity data recorded in 1967.
